The Zinn Education Project
is a collaboration between
Rethinking Schools and Teaching for Change
The goal is to introduce students to a more accurate, complex, and
engaging understanding of United States history than is found in
traditional textbooks and curricula. The empowering potential of
studying U.S. history is often lost in a textbook-driven trivial
pursuit of names and dates. Zinn’s
A People’s History of the United States emphasizes
the role of working people, women, people of color, and organized
social movements in shaping history. Students learn that history is
made not by a few heroic individuals, but instead by people’s choices
and actions and therefore students’ own choices and actions also
matter. For more information, visit
